Xunlei confirms Google Investment

By Om Malik | Wednesday, December 27, 2006 | 9:06 PM PT | 0 comments |

Shenzhen Xunlei Network Technology, the Chinese P2P video software company has confirmed that Google will become an investor in the company, according to a Bloomberg news report. The confirmation from a company official comes nearly 20-days after Katie has reported on the pending investment. Bloomberg story is scant on details for now.
